Route Description
Everything you need to know about the corridor San José - Salamá
This cross-border corridor connects San José, Costa Rica, to Salamá, Guatemala, spanning approximately 888 km. It serves as a vital strategic link for trade between Central America's key economies, facilitating the movement of goods through diverse landscapes and regulatory environments. The corridor's importance lies in its ability to connect major commercial hubs, supporting regional supply chain integration.
The economic context features a blend of agricultural strength, manufacturing, and growing industrial sectors. This route is heavily utilized by industries such as agriculture, textiles, and general manufacturing, which rely on efficient transport to move raw materials and finished products. The infrastructure primarily follows major national routes, including sections of the Pan-American Highway, which provides the necessary backbone for heavy-duty operations.

Origin
San José
San José serves as a strategic logistics hub within Costa Rica, offering efficient connectivity to both regional and international markets. Its central location allows for streamlined distribution across the country and beyond. The city supports key economic sectors including technology, services, agriculture, and light manufacturing, driving consistent freight activity.
The transportation infrastructure in San José includes access to major highways and international gateways, ensuring robust connectivity for cargo movement. This infrastructure supports the export of local goods and the import of necessary resources. Destination
Salamá
Salamá is a significant logistics center in the Guatemalan highlands, offering strategic access to the northern and western regions of the country. Its location supports industries such as textiles, agriculture, and manufacturing, creating a steady demand for reliable freight services. The city's economic activity is bolstered by its role as a distribution point for surrounding areas.
The transportation infrastructure around Salamá includes key national routes that facilitate the movement of heavy and specialized cargo. This connectivity is essential for businesses needing to transport goods efficiently within Guatemala and to neighboring countries.
